Darkness
By Fallon Sanada
A/N: Poem from Cale.. ah, more misunderstood Warlords..
I sit in a room
surrounded by the dark
and to all appearances
I am not even alive.
I sit in the darkness
not afraid of the light
but the darkness invites me
when the light has had enough.
I sit surrounded by the dark
shadows gather 'round.
I shall tell them a tale
of a battle I had.
They take shapes of people
that I ought to know
inviting the story
that to them I bestow.
I sit amongst shadows
no light to be seen.
I see fine though
no problems
are presented in this scene.
I sit in the darkness
composed of the sorrow of this world
yet I do not feel
as though I am alone.
For the shadows protect me
in the darkness I lay
as the darkness I love
waits for me to go away.
